Output d3e5b0cd2c71981ae3f5740643186b6dc3c833e90248d7814e6c7ba4ed799ec9:0

value
24542
script pubkey
OP_0 OP_PUSHBYTES_20 8d7679612321460501f7a9a9fbdb8450ddef00da
address
bc1q34m8jcfry9rq2q0h4x5lhkuy2rw77qx6xcrw8u
transaction
d3e5b0cd2c71981ae3f5740643186b6dc3c833e90248d7814e6c7ba4ed799ec9
confirmations
142547
spent
true